Amazon product image size spec (2026)
Amazon's photo rules turn on three thresholds: 1000 px minimum (which also activates zoom), the 2000–3000 px recommended range Seller Central calls the sweet spot, and a 10,000 px maximum per side. The recommended range is what moves the needle — listings whose photos clear the zoom threshold and render crisp on Retina screens convert measurably better, especially for apparel, electronics, and home goods where buyers inspect texture and detail before adding to cart.
| Spec | Amazon requirement |
|---|---|
| Recommended longest side | 2000–3000 px (Seller Central 2026) |
| Minimum | 1000 px (also zoom threshold) |
| Maximum | 10,000 px per side |
| Main image background | Pure white RGB (255, 255, 255) |
| Product frame fill | ≥ 85% |
| Accepted formats | JPEG (preferred), TIFF, PNG, GIF |
| Max file size | 10 MB per image |
| Photos per listing | Up to 9 (main + 8 alt) |
Source: Amazon Seller Central — Product Image Guide
Amazon product images and the A+ Content uplift
Amazon treats product photos as a two-tier system: the main image (photo #1) is governed by strict catalog rules (pure white background, product fills 85% of frame, no text or props), while alt images (photos #2–9) are where you actually sell — infographics, lifestyle shots, size comparisons, feature callouts.
Brand-registered sellers unlock a third layer: A+ Content, a section below the standard listing that supports hero modules (970 × 600), comparison tables (300 × 300), and brand storytelling panels (1464 × 600). Amazon photo tips that convert
- Main image on pure white only. Amazon enforces RGB 255, 255, 255 algorithmically — "Fit with white padding" guarantees it and avoids automated rejection.
- Fill 85%+ of the frame. Tight, centered framing beats negative space and is required by policy for the main shot.
- Use all 6–9 slots. Listings with 5+ images outperform sparse listings by double-digit percentages — add size charts, infographics, and lifestyle scenes.
- Upload JPEG directly. Amazon serves JPEG to shoppers, so JPEG input skips its internal re-encode and preserves your source quality.
- Resize down, never up. Amazon's review pipeline flags upscaling artifacts — start from a 3000 px+ master and shrink to 2000 × 2000.
Frequently asked questions
What's Amazon's recommended product image size in 2026?
Amazon's 2026 Seller Central guidance recommends 2000–3000 pixels on the longest side. Zoom activates at 1000 px, but 2000 × 2000 is the sweet spot. Source: Amazon Seller Central — Product Image Guide.
Why does Amazon keep rejecting my main product image?
Top rejection reasons: non-pure-white background (Amazon requires RGB 255, 255, 255 exactly), product filling less than 85% of frame, and text, logos, or watermarks. This tool's "Fit with white padding" produces exact #FFFFFF.
Does Amazon require a pure white background on the main image?
Yes, enforced algorithmically. Main images must be pure white RGB (255, 255, 255). Secondary images (photos #2–9) can use any background.
How much of the main image frame must the product occupy?
Amazon's policy requires the product to fill at least 85% of the frame. Too much negative space triggers automated review flags.
JPEG or PNG for Amazon product listings?
JPEG is strongly preferred — it's what Amazon serves shoppers, so uploading JPEG directly skips Amazon's internal re-encoding step.
How many photos can I upload per Amazon listing?
Up to 9 photos (1 main + 8 alt). Amazon's conversion data shows listings with 5+ images outperform those with fewer by double-digit percentages.
Do main and alt images follow different rules?
Main: pure white background, product fills 85%, no text/props. Alt images: can be lifestyle, infographics, comparisons, feature callouts.
What size should I use for Amazon A+ Content images?
A+ Content uses different specs: hero module 970 × 600, comparison thumbs 300 × 300, full-width banners 1464 × 600. Use this tool's Custom pixel input for A+ modules.
